Cascadia Waterfront Promenade

Description
A rustic shoreline Park with pleasant lighting that does not flatten terrain, so it can be placed on a shoreline and leave the slope to decline naturally. Shows whatever is beneath (sand, grass)
Just what you need for a boreal, temperate or European location!
